#include <iostream> #include <codecogs/finance/banking/nperiods.h> int main(void) { printf("nPeriods(0.01, -100, -1000, 10000, pp_StartOfPeriod) = %lf\n", Finance::Banking::nPeriods(0.01, -100, -1000, 10000, Finance::Banking::pp_StartOfPeriod)); printf("nPeriods(0.01, -100, -1000, 10000, pp_EndOfPeriod) = %lf\n", Finance::Banking::nPeriods(0.01, -100, -1000, 10000, Finance::Banking::pp_EndOfPeriod)); printf("nPeriods(0.01, -100, 1000, 0, pp_EndOfPeriod) = %lf\n", Finance::Banking::nPeriods(0.01, -100, 1000, 0, Finance::Banking::pp_EndOfPeriod)); return 1; }Output:
nPeriods(0.01, -100, -1000, 10000, pp_StartOfPeriod) = 59.673866 nPeriods(0.01, -100, -1000, 10000, pp_EndOfPeriod) = 60.082123 nPeriods(0.01, -100, 1000, 0, pp_EndOfPeriod) = 10.588644
